Gentle daily exercises to activate nerves, improve circulation, and rebuild muscle strength.
Choose brain-repair foods rich in omega-3, antioxidants, good fats, and clean proteins.
Prioritize deep, restorative sleep to strengthen neuroplasticity and emotional stability.
Repeat functional tasks daily to retrain the brain and reinforce new neural pathways.
